C# SMS API keepalive
To keepalive the IP SMS link between the C# SMS API and the sms gateway you need to establish a permanent connection with the C# SMS API's connect method. The system will automatically send keepalive requests.
The C#/.Net SMS api keepalive procedure
To send keepalive requests from the C#/.Net SMS api simply keep the connection open
- Step 1: Create connection
- Step 2: 30 seconds of inactivity
- Step 3: Send keepalive to keep the TCP/IP link open
C# sms api keepalive example:
Client.Connect(host,port,user,pass); ... Keepalive packets are sent automatically if there is no traffic ... Client.Send(msg);
Keepalive packets are necessary because firewall rules, vpn connections or dynamically allocated IP SMS routes on the Internet could be disconnected after a period of inactivity. By sending keepalive packets both the C# SMS API client and the SMS gateway can be certain, that the connection is still open.
Keepalive packets are only sent if no other SMS traffic is moving on the link.
